A technology consultancy in the UK is seeking a Senior Dynamics 365 Functional Consultant to design and deliver innovative solutions on the Microsoft Dynamics 365 platform. This is a remote position, requiring occasional travel to client sites in Glasgow or Reading.

The ideal candidate will have significant experience with Dynamics 365, strong client consultancy skills, and the ability to lead project teams.

A competitive salary up to £75,000 plus benefits is offered.

How to prepare for a job interview at Bright Purple

Know Your Dynamics 365 Inside Out

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of Dynamics 365 and the Power Platform. Be ready to discuss specific projects you've worked on, the challenges you faced, and how you overcame them. This will show your depth of experience and problem-solving skills.

Showcase Your Consultancy Skills

Prepare examples that highlight your client consultancy skills. Think about times when you successfully managed client expectations or delivered solutions that exceeded their needs. This is crucial for a role that involves leading project teams and working closely with clients.

Be Ready for Scenario-Based Questions

Expect scenario-based questions that assess your ability to design and deliver solutions. Practice articulating your thought process and decision-making in these scenarios. This will demonstrate your analytical skills and how you approach complex problems.
